TresJS

Vue 3 framework for building 3D scenes with Three.js. Declarative components that wrap Three.js objects.

Packages: @tresjs/core (required), @tresjs/cientos (helpers), @tresjs/post-processing (effects)

Installation

# Core (required)
pnpm add three @tresjs/core

# Helpers - controls, loaders, materials, staging
pnpm add @tresjs/cientos

# Post-processing effects
pnpm add @tresjs/post-processing

Core Concepts

TresCanvas

Root component that creates WebGL renderer and scene:

<script setup lang="ts">
import { TresCanvas } from '@tresjs/core'
</script>

<template>
  <TresCanvas shadows alpha>
    <TresPerspectiveCamera :position="[5, 5, 5]" />
    <TresMesh>
      <TresBoxGeometry />
      <TresMeshStandardMaterial color="orange" />
    </TresMesh>
    <TresAmbientLight :intensity="0.5" />
    <TresDirectionalLight :position="[3, 3, 3]" :intensity="1" />
  </TresCanvas>
</template>

Component Naming

All Three.js classes available as Vue components with Tres prefix:

  • THREE.PerspectiveCamera<TresPerspectiveCamera />
  • THREE.Mesh<TresMesh />
  • THREE.BoxGeometry<TresBoxGeometry />
  • THREE.MeshStandardMaterial<TresMeshStandardMaterial />

Constructor arguments via :args prop:

<TresPerspectiveCamera :args="[75, 1, 0.1, 1000]" />

Reactivity

Props are reactive - changes update the 3D scene:

<script setup>
const color = ref('orange')
const position = ref([0, 0, 0])
</script>

<template>
  <TresMesh :position="position">
    <TresMeshStandardMaterial :color="color" />
  </TresMesh>
</template>

Primitive Component

Inject existing Three.js objects directly:

<script setup>
import { useGLTF } from '@tresjs/cientos'
const { scene } = await useGLTF('/model.glb')
</script>

<template>
  <primitive :object="scene" />
</template>
